McLaren reserve driver Leonardo Fornaroli has completed his first Formula 1 tests, covering more than 900km (560 miles) with the team’s 2023 machinery. The reigning Formula 2 champion failed to find a seat in the world championship for 2026 and settled for a reserve role at McLaren – that was the first time he associated with an F1 team.
